pounder
noun
/ˈpaʊndər/

Definition
A pounder is someone or something that pounds or crushes materials down into smaller pieces or a specific weight.

Meaning
The term can refer to a person who pounds, such as in cooking or construction, or it can be used informally to describe something that weighs a pound, often in the context of measuring or weighing items.
